我是这样解决的:
MyClass.objects.filter(name__iexact=my_parameter)
甚至有一种方法可以将其用于子字符串搜索:
MyClass.objects.filter(name__icontains=my_parameter)
有一个指向文档的链接。
问题内容: 如何在Django中查询/过滤并忽略查询字符串的大小写? 我有类似的事情,并且喜欢忽略以下情况: 问题答案: 我这样解决了: 甚至可以使用它来进行子字符串搜索:
问题内容: 我正在使用Flask-SQLAlchemy从用户数据库中查询;但是,虽然 will return doing returns 我想知道是否有一种以不区分大小写的方式查询数据库的方法,以便第二个示例仍然返回 问题答案: 你可以使用过滤器中的或功能来完成此操作: 另一种选择是使用而不是进行搜索:
问题内容: 有谁知道如何使用Postgres 7.4进行不区分大小写的搜索/查询? 我在考虑RegEx,但不确定如何执行此操作,或者不确定是否有函数/标志或可以添加查询的内容? 我正在使用PHP连接并执行查询。 因此,我正在寻找匹配地址信息的方法。 例子: 有什么想法吗? 问题答案: 使用,例如: 文件资料。 或者,您可以使用或,例如:
问题内容: 我的用户名基本上是唯一的(不区分大小写),但是按用户提供的显示时大小写很重要。 我有以下要求: 字段与CharField兼容 字段是唯一的,但不区分大小写 字段需要可忽略大小写进行搜索(避免使用iexact,容易忘记) 字段存储的情况不变 最好在数据库级别执行 最好避免存储额外的字段 在Django中可能吗? 我想出的唯一解决方案是“以某种方式”覆盖模型管理器,使用额外的字段或在搜索中
问题内容: 我有这个json文件: 我使用以下Go代码搜索数据: 它会查找是否通过“板球”之类的相同字符串进行搜索,但是如果我搜索此“板球”之类的字符串,则不会找到它。 问题答案: 添加到您的RegEx。
我有一个Spring Data Neo4j(3.4.0.RELEASE)实体,它带有一个